We are proud of the design awards and recognition earned by the TRO JB team, including the prestigious national AIA Healthcare Award for our design of the Shenzhen Third People’s Infectious Disease Hospital in Shenzhen, China and the Best Healthcare Award from IIDA New England for interior design completed for Partners Healthcare at Newton-Wellesley Hospital.
Other national and regional honors for our work include awards from the Boston Society of Architects (BSA), World Architecture News, Building Design and Construction Magazine, AIA New England, the Brick Industry Association, the Construction Management Association of America, the Illuminating Engineering Society of North America, AIA Alabama, AIA Memphis and AIA Birmingham.
